How to calculate the cost of breast augmentation surgery

How to calculate the cost of breast augmentation surgery

Breast augmentation surgery is a method of enlarging women's breasts through surgery, which has become more and more popular among women in recent years. Different hospitals and doctors will have different charging standards. The following details how to calculate the cost of breast augmentation surgery from hospital selection, surgical methods, implant materials and other costs.

 How to calculate the cost of breast augmentation surgery

Hospital selection

First of all, choosing the right hospital is one of the important factors that determine the cost. High quality hospitals usually charge more than ordinary hospitals, but also provide better medical environment, equipment and services. Some large general hospitals or well-known plastic surgery hospitals usually have higher costs, while some small specialized hospitals have relatively low costs.

In addition, hospitals in different regions may have different costs. Generally speaking, hospital costs in first tier cities are relatively high, while those in second tier and third tier cities are relatively low. Therefore, if patients' conditions permit, they can choose to go to other regions for medical treatment to reduce costs.

Finally, doctors' experience and reputation should be considered when selecting hospitals. Experienced and skilled doctors may charge higher fees.

Operation mode

There are different ways of breast augmentation surgery, such as silica gel implantation, saline implantation and autologous fat transplantation. Different surgical methods will affect the calculation of surgical expenses.

Silicone implant is the most common method of breast augmentation surgery, and its cost is usually high. Silicone implants need special implants, and the cost of surgical materials is high, so the cost is relatively high.

Normal saline implantation is a more economical and affordable method of breast augmentation surgery. The implant is an implant bag filled with physiological saline, and its cost is lower than that of silicone implant.

Autologous fat transplantation is a method of breast augmentation using the patient's own fat. Compared with other methods, autologous fat transplantation costs more. The operation requires extra fat extraction and fine implantation, which is relatively difficult and expensive.

Implant materials

Breast augmentation surgery requires the use of special implant materials, and different implant materials will also affect the cost calculation.

At present, the common implant materials on the market mainly include silica gel and physiological saline. The price of silicone implants is relatively high, but they have better texture and natural effects. The price of saline implants is relatively low, but the hand feel and effect are relatively poor.

In addition, some high-end implant materials also have special functions, such as shape memory function or adjustable volume function, which will also increase the cost of implants.

other expenses

In addition to the cost of surgery and implants, there are other costs to consider.

The cost of preoperative examination includes various examinations performed by doctors on patients, such as blood examination, breast examination, etc. Postoperative recovery costs include follow-up costs, drug costs and related nursing costs.

Anesthesia cost refers to the cost of anesthesia services provided by anesthetists during the whole operation process. Generally speaking, the cost of anesthesia is calculated by hour. The longer the operation time is, the higher the cost of anesthesia will be.

Finally, we need to consider the hospitalization expenses during the operation. The operation needs to be carried out in the hospital. There is a certain length of hospital stay, and the cost of hospitalization needs to be included.
